Title :
Index-Guiding, Single-Mode, Liquid-Core, Liquid-Cladding Photonic Crystal Fibers

Abstract :
Index-guiding, hollow-core photonic crystal fibers whose core and cladding have been filled with different liquids are theoretically and experimentally demonstrated. These waveguides present a single-mode operation and applicability in sensing and nonlinear optics of liquids.
